Check for power at the motor, if you have power, replace motor.

If there is no power, move back to the switch... if you have power going in but not out (with switch on) replace the switch.
If there IS power coming out, but not getting to the motor, find the break in the wire.

If there is no power going into the switch, find out why... a break in teh wire between fuse and switch.

(did you just look at the fuse... or did you test it?)

If the fuse is good, my money is on the wiper motor.
